The Forrester Gallery is stepping into 2023 with a new offering of exhibitions, all celebrating Waitaki talent in this four-show extravaganza - Zeitgeist: works by Peter Cleverley, The New Nine | Eion Shanks, Alchemy | Trish Shirley and Soulstice | Katie Waite. The opening of all four exhibitions was celebrated with the artists and their supporters Friday, 27 January.

In 2021 the Forrester Gallery began working with Peter Cleverley on a solo show that celebrates his past and present work in our own collection, in private collections and work being done currently. This show cements Peter Cleverley as a New Zealand artist and comments on his significance and contribution to contemporary painting. The exhibition includes the first work of Peter’s that the Forrester Gallery purchased back in 1984 through to his most recently finished works. “It has been a real privilege to work with Peter Cleverley on Zeitgeist: Works by Peter Cleverley. Peter’s work has a strong connection to the Waitaki region, and his practice has always been supported by local collectors. It feels right to be having this solo exhibition at the Forrester at a time of transition in his career.” – Imogen Stockwell, Curator, Visual Arts, Forrester Gallery

We have also opened three other shows by three Waitaki artists. The New Nine is a new exhibition by Eion Shanks that examines climate change. Eion has drawn on the David Attenborough documentary Breaking Boundaries: The Science of our Planet for this show. In standard Eion practice, there is a strong current of black humour that runs through the exhibition to bring our attention to this issue.

Alchemy is an exhibition of Trish Shirley’s work that celebrates artists as alchemists who create meaning by taking ingredients – concepts and materials – and transforming them into artwork. This colourful exhibition makes us think about how artists work their magic, the idea of transformation and the impact that creating has on the artist themselves.

Katy Waite is a new exhibiting artist for the Forrester Gallery. Her show, Soulstice is a celebration of Katy’s love of colour. The works are the result of a New Zealand autumn and winter in lockdown and then a spring and summer in Portugal.
